Is It Possible To Take A Paternity Test During Pregnancy?

can you take a paternity test during pregnancy

Paternity testing has become more accessible and accurate in recent years, allowing people to confirm biological relationships with a simple DNA test. However, one common question that arises is whether it’s possible to take a paternity test while pregnant. The short answer is yes, but there are some considerations to keep in mind.

Traditionally, paternity tests are conducted using DNA samples from the potential father, child, and mother. But what if the mother is still pregnant? Can a paternity test be done in this case? The answer is yes, but it’s a bit more complicated than testing after the child is born.

One method of paternity testing during pregnancy is through non-invasive prenatal paternity testing (NIPP), also known as non-invasive prenatal paternity testing. This type of test analyzes cell-free fetal DNA (cffDNA) that is circulating in the mother’s blood during pregnancy. The test can determine paternity with a high degree of accuracy, similar to traditional paternity tests.

NIPP testing is typically done after the 8th week of pregnancy and involves taking a blood sample from the mother. The process is safe and poses no risk to the fetus. The sample is then sent to a laboratory for analysis, where the fetal DNA is separated from the mother’s DNA to determine paternity. Results are usually available within a few days to a week.

While NIPP testing is highly accurate and non-invasive, it’s important to note that it is not legally admissible in all states for paternity establishment. Some states require a court-admissible test to establish paternity for legal purposes, such as child support or custody arrangements. Therefore, it’s essential to check the laws in your state before pursuing a paternity test during pregnancy.

Another method of paternity testing during pregnancy is through invasive prenatal paternity testing, also known as amniocentesis or chorionic villus sampling (CVS). These procedures involve collecting fetal DNA from the amniotic fluid or placental tissue through a needle inserted into the mother’s abdomen. While these tests can accurately determine paternity, they carry a small risk of miscarriage, making them less desirable for paternity testing purposes.

Invasive prenatal testing is usually reserved for medical purposes, such as detecting genetic disorders or chromosomal abnormalities in the fetus. It is not commonly used for paternity testing unless there are extenuating circumstances that require it.
